Rajvi Deposit Guide 2025: Minimum Deposit Requirements, Methods, and Processes Explained

Part One: rajvi Minimum Deposit Requirements

rajvi Minimum Deposit Explained

When considering opening an account with rajvi, it's essential to understand the minimum deposit requirements. The rajvi minimum deposit is set at ₹10,000 for both the trading and demat accounts. This amount is consistent across various account types offered by the broker, which include standard trading accounts and demat accounts.

Comparison of Minimum Deposit Requirements for Different Account Types

  • Trading Account: Minimum deposit of ₹10,000.
  • Demat Account: Minimum deposit of ₹10,000.
  • 3-in-1 Account: Currently, rajvi does not offer a combined 3-in-1 account.

Part Two: rajvi Deposit Methods

rajvi Deposit Methods Comprehensive Guide

rajvi offers multiple deposit methods to cater to the diverse needs of its clients. Understanding these rajvi deposit methods is crucial for a seamless trading experience.

Overview of All Available Deposit Methods:

  1. Bank Transfers
  2. Credit/Debit Cards
  3. E-wallets
  4. Local Payment Methods

Detailed Explanation of Each Method

1. Bank Transfers

  • Processing Time: Typically 1-3 business days.
  • Fees: Usually free of charge, but check with your bank for any potential fees.
  • Regional Availability: Widely available across India.
  • Pros: Secure and reliable; allows for larger deposits.
  • Cons: Processing times may vary, causing delays in fund availability.

2. Credit/Debit Cards

  • Processing Time: Instant.
  • Fees: May incur a small transaction fee depending on the card issuer.
  • Regional Availability: Accepted nationwide.
  • Pros: Quick and convenient for immediate trading.
  • Cons: Limited deposit amounts may apply.

3. E-wallets

  • Processing Time: Instant to a few hours.
  • Fees: Varies by provider; typically low.
  • Regional Availability: Depends on the e-wallet service used.
  • Pros: Fast and user-friendly.
  • Cons: Not universally accepted; potential for higher fees.

4. Local Payment Methods

  • Processing Time: Varies by method.
  • Fees: May vary based on the local payment service.
  • Regional Availability: Limited to specific regions.
  • Pros: Can be more accessible for local users.
  • Cons: May not be as secure as bank transfers.

Supported Deposit Currencies

rajvi primarily supports deposits in Indian Rupees (INR).

For speed and convenience, bank transfers and credit/debit cards are recommended methods, as they provide instant access to funds and are widely accepted.

Part Three: rajvi Deposit Process Guide

rajvi Deposit Process Steps Explained

Understanding the rajvi deposit process is essential to ensure your funds are deposited smoothly. Below are the steps for making a deposit via the website.

Website Deposit Steps

Step 1: Log into your rajvi trading account.

Step 2: Navigate to the "Funds" or "Deposit" section.

Step 3: Select your preferred deposit method (e.g., bank transfer, credit card).

Step 4: Enter the deposit amount and any required payment details.

Step 5: Confirm the transaction and wait for the confirmation message.

Mobile App Deposit Steps (if applicable)

  1. Open the rajvi mobile app and log in.
  2. Go to the "Deposit" section.
  3. Choose your deposit method.
  4. Enter the amount and payment details.
  5. Confirm the deposit.

Specific Deposit Processes for Each Payment Method

  • Bank Transfer: After initiating the transfer, upload the transaction receipt on the rajvi platform for faster processing.
  • Credit/Debit Card: Enter card details securely and confirm the transaction.
  • E-wallet: Link your e-wallet and follow the prompts to complete the deposit.

Common Deposit Issues and Solutions

  • Deposit Failures: Ensure that your payment details are correct; contact customer support if issues persist.
  • Processing Delays: Check the transaction status; delays can occur due to bank processing times.
  • Identity Verification Issues: Ensure all KYC documents are submitted correctly.
  • Deposit Limit Issues: Contact customer support to discuss increasing your deposit limits if necessary.

Fund Crediting Time After Deposit Completion

Typically, funds are credited within 1-3 business days for bank transfers and instantly for credit/debit cards and e-wallets.
